Webco Mannesmann Chop Saw Stand
II'm building pigmy walls for a Victorian Shape comservatory, which has a half hexigon bow end. This means i have to cut many house bricks to get the angles i need. Using a heavy angle grinder this soon gets tedious as welll as difficult to see rhrough all the dust.I tried the guilotine type cutters where you hit with a club hammer but engineering bricks are very hard to cut at an angle. This stand converts a 9" Grinder to a chop saw allowing a much easier task and repeatable results.With this unit i bought from Amazon a Wolf 9" grinder, the two side handle holes are used to secure the grinder to the stand, but the bolts supplied are to big for this grinder. To over come I had to grind down the ends of both bolts for about 1cm using a bench grinder.This stand could be far more versatile had it come with the ends of the bolts already ground to more of a point. The instructions on assembly need better discriptions as i can see serious accidents ahead for the less wary. Th base plate is pressed steal and easily distorts so advice is to bolt it down to a piece of 25mm Ply then gripp the wood to a work mate type table, weight the table with bricks or sand bags.House bricks don't quit fit in so you need to make a cut then snap off the last bit, if this leaves a 'snot' then make a cleaning pass from another direction.This stand is well worth having, be aware unlike a normal chop saw used for cutting wood, it will present very easy opertunitues to self amputate fingers and limbs, check your grinder will fit if it properly, especially if you don't have the mechanical skills to be adaptive - or at least own a bench grinder ;).

Dangerous grinder stand !!
Poor grinder stand ! Of very poor construction ! Main chassis far too light for a 9 inch grinder ! The Base is made of a very light material which causes the grinder holder arm to sway from side to side when cutting which makes this unit dangerous to say the least ! .. I made a new Base for mine out of 5mm steel plate to make the whole unit safe to use !
